Table of ContentsReviews""America the Abandoned captures an amorphous time between the past and the future at once frozen in time and ever-changing. Brian's vision of America is a place I want to curl up in and never leave.""--Elizabeth Finkelstein, founder of Cheap Old Houses ""Bryan Sansivero illuminates all the haunted beauty of America's deserted homes in his new book. He finds unsettled spirits among the ruin, all of which he photographs in sumptuous color. In short, his photographs manage to inhabit the souls of the people who once lived there.""--Laura Holson, writer, traveler, and founder of The Box Sessions ""The texture of ruin with the radiance of Technicolor. A classic in the urbex catalog.""--Dylan Thuras, cofounder of Atlas Obscura Author InformationBryan Sansivero is a renowned and award-winning photographer known for his colorful, evocative, and unique pictures of abandoned places. He is a filmmaker whose eye for detail and his documentative style will bring the viewer on an emotional journey into places rarely ventured or seen.
